    I have a web application that needs to be accesible over an HTTPS connection, not HTTP.
    When I deploy an application with Java Studio Creator to the App Server it is automatically set to an HTTP URL. How do I setup HTTPS ?
    Thank you in advance,
    Joe Paladin

    Looks like I should have thanked myself in advance....
    Turns out its pretty easy. Open the admin console, go to configuration, add and HTTP listener, check the security check box, and fill out the other mandatory fields like the port. Standard SSL port is 443.
    Save changes, and restart the App Server. Any deployed apps should be reachable via https://localhost:443/myWebApp
    This approach uses a default certificate that comes with the app server. Here is a link if you want to create a certificate :

    How to find a listening port number of app. server?
    Thanks,
    Jim

    Check on the midtier home, the %ORACLE_HOME%\Apcahe\Apache\conf\httpd.conf file for port directive. Or if you have SSL-configured on the AS, the check ssl.conf file in the same location for the same directive.
    or Alternatively, log on to the EM for midtier. Go to ports and see the Webcache port for listen.
    Remember that these will be the listen ports for Webcache. For port where OHS will listen can be obtained by looking for Listen directive in the above files, and on EM, the port listed for OHS Listen (or SSL Listen, in case of SSL).

    After spending more time looking through the forum, I came across the below thread which has worked in my case (though it was suggested for Sol10x86).
    http://forum.sun.com/jive/thread.jspa?threadID=62404&messageID=243113
    This is the workaround that worked in my case.
    > $ cd <Creator_Home>/SunAppServer8/lib
    $ mv processLauncher.xml processLauncher.xml.trayIcon
    $ cp processLauncher.xml.bak processLauncher.xml
    # If you have a domains/creator/config/domain.xml
    $ cd ../bin
    $ ./asadmin start-domain creator
    This started the app server. After that I was able to start and stop app server within the JSC as well.
    Only difference between these two xml files seem to be,
    processLauncher.xml.trayicon
    <main_class classname="com.sun.rave.tray.RavePEMain"/>
    processLauncher.xml
    <main_class classname="com.sun.enterprise.server.PEMain"/>
    Possibly pointing to a bug in the "com.sun.rave.tray.RavePEMain" class.

    "PSAPPSRV.3643 (0) 10/19/09 15:48:43(3) File: SQL Access ManagerSQL error. Stmt #: 2 Error Position: 0 Return: 404 - ORA-01017: invalid username/password; logon denied
    PSAPPSRV.3643 (0) 10/19/09 15:48:43(1) GenMessageBox(200, 0, M): SQL Access Manager: File: SQL Access ManagerSQL error. Stmt #: 2 Error Position: 0 Return: 404 - ORA-01017: invalid username/password; logon denied"
    sounds like something to do with connect-id or access-id.
    are you able to login to datamover using sysadm user ?
    if yes ...can you try to login and run
    set log c:\temp\test1.log;
    UPDATE PSSTATUS SET OWNERID = 'SYSADM';
    UPDATE PSOPRDEFN SET SYMBOLICID = 'SYSADM1', OPERPSWD = 'upg2009', ENCRYPTED = 0 WHERE OPRID = 'VP1';
    UPDATE PSACCESSPRFL SET ACCESSID = 'SYSADM', SYMBOLICID = 'SYSADM1', ACCESSPSWD = 'fin23SQL', VERSION = 0, ENCRYPTED = 0;
    GRANT SELECT ON PSSTATUS TO people;
    GRANT SELECT ON PSOPRDEFN TO people;
    GRANT SELECT ON PSACCESSPRFL TO people;
    REM - ENCRYPT PASSWORD
    SET LOG c:\temp\encrypt.log;
    ENCRYPT_PASSWORD *;
    Also check PSDBOWNER, it should contain only one row and DB Name should be in caps/lower same case as DB name ...somting it also causes issue.
